CHAPTER EIGHT

‘Y ou know, I’ve never had a date in a railway station before,’ said Cassie.

Ranjit grinned. ‘You don’t know what you’ve been missing.’

No kidding. Cassie was really pleased when Ranjit had suggested a bit of sightseeing together earlier that afternoon. She’d felt as if a

distance had opened up between them after their spat in the common room, and Cassie had been hopeful that his suggestion of an

afternoon alone could be enough to change that. However, when he brought her to a train station she wasn’t quite so sure it was going to

be the romantic reconciliation she was hoping for after all.

Luckily, it didn’t take long to change her mind when Ranjit led her up to the Oyster Bar. Even with her limited experience of such matters,

Cassie had a glimmer of hope that the crustaceans might provide an early-evening aphrodisiac …

‘Good, aren’t they?’ Ranjit looked up from under his long, dark lashes and grinned. As he returned to his plate of expensive shellfish,

Cassie eyed her fellow diners. The three women at the next table were animated, laughing at some juicy piece of gossip. She watched their

mouths, sniffed delicately at the scent of their breath. Their lively auras were almost more appealing than oysters, but she wasn’t afraid of

attacking them. Not yet. Inside her, the hunger was quiet. The Tears of the Few were still doing their job, thank goodness. She still had time.

‘You’re all right, aren’t you?’ Ranjit asked, reaching a hand over to touch hers.

Her skin tingled. ‘Absolutely.’ As if to prove it, she swallowed another oyster, and leaned contentedly back in her chair. The ceiling above

her was stunning: vaulted and tiled and glowing with light. ‘What a beautiful place.’

‘I know it sounds weird, but the main terminal’s even better.’ He laughed. ‘Are you finished? I’ll get the bill and we can go upstairs.’

Dropping his napkin on the red checked tablecloth, he nodded to a waiter. Handing over a shiny black credit card, he paid without checking

the amount. Cassie gave a short, private laugh. The casual wealth of the students at the Darke Academy never ceased to amaze her.

Ranjit walked around and helped her into her coat, and she smiled as he rested his hands on her shoulders for a fraction longer than

necessary.

‘Hey, is everything cool with you and Jake?’

Cassie hesitated, surprised at his question – and on guard after what had happened when he’d brought up the subject of Richard. ‘Yeah.

Why wouldn’t it be?’

‘I don’t know. I just haven’t seen him hanging out with you as much as usual recently. I know he’s not exactly thrilled with the idea of us

being together. And after what happened to Jess, I can’t imagine he’s happy about you feeding on Isabella either.’

Cassie silently cursed his perceptiveness. Jake had indeed been keeping his distance since their ‘chat’ in computer science. But how

much could she tell Ranjit? She wasn’t ready to let anyone else know about Jake’s one-man campaign to bring Katerina to justice, that was

for sure.

She bought a little time by knotting her scarf carefully. At last she gave Ranjit an apologetic grin. ‘Yeah, you have a point. Things have

been a bit … tense. But actually, he doesn’t know about the feeding thing yet.’

He raised his eyebrows. ‘Really? Well, maybe that’s for the best. But how long do you think you can keep it from him? Jake isn’t stupid.’
